Output 5583d3726a3d0fbc8db1596b499979f70af2d2190a76df48fecbd73d8a2ef5ef:162

value
1830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51ab2b9763c9664053e3e198e3f8b3988b967cd9 OP_EQUAL
address
398qiCe4HF22XXZexMqFyWyDgaw1t4NDBV
transaction
5583d3726a3d0fbc8db1596b499979f70af2d2190a76df48fecbd73d8a2ef5ef
confirmations
44065
spent
true